> Hi John,
>     I see you added that very nice example and also a screenshot for
> it... unfortunately it doesn't run on my linux with latest wxLua
> compiled & installed:
>
> [EMAIL PROTECTED]:~/work/wxLua/samples$ wxlua wxluasudoku.wx.lua
> wxLua: Syntax error during pre-compilation
> wxluasudoku.wx.lua:193: malformed number near `9.1'
> wxLua: Syntax error during pre-compilation
>
> Maybe the dot must be replaced with a comma ?
> Doing the replace in line 193 makes wxLua complain for next occurrences
> .... probably if I'd solve them all, it would just run.
> What I do not understand is why it works with you ?

It works fine here, I want to divide by the number 9.1 = 91E-1.

> Could it be a locale problem ?

It seems like it is, I don't know how to solve it for you. Change you
system locale to "C" maybe? I think that's what I use.
